Did Piet Mondrian adopt any children?

No, Piet Mondrian did not adopt any children. Throughout his life, he remained focused on his art and personal pursuits, without starting a family. Mondrian was known for his dedication to his work, particularly in developing his distinctive style of abstract painting.


Who studied pite mondrian?

Colin McCahon, an artist himself, studied Piet Mondrian's paintings, and commented positively on his work. McCahon was an artist from New Zealand.
